Benefits

Pattern hair products offer a multitude of benefits, including nourishment, hydration, curl definition, and frizz control. Each of these benefits plays a vital role in maintaining healthy, beautiful curls.

  • Nourishment: Pattern hair products provide essential nutrients to the hair shaft, strengthening and repairing damage. This can help to prevent breakage and promote healthy hair growth.
  • Hydration: Curly hair tends to be drier than other hair types, so it is important to use products that provide deep hydration. Pattern hair products contain humectants that draw moisture into the hair shaft, leaving curls feeling soft, supple, and defined.
  • Curl Definition: Pattern hair products help to define and enhance natural curls. They contain ingredients that help to hold curls in place, preventing them from becoming frizzy or undefined.
  • Frizz Control: Frizz is a common problem for curly hair, but it can be tamed with the right products. Pattern hair products contain anti-frizz ingredients that help to smooth the hair shaft and prevent flyaways.

By providing these essential benefits, pattern hair products can help individuals with curly hair to achieve healthy, beautiful curls that are full of life and vitality.

Types

Pattern hair products encompass a diverse range of types, each tailored to specific curl patterns and hair needs. These types can be broadly categorized into creams, gels, leave-in conditioners, and styling aids, each with unique characteristics and benefits.

  • Creams: Curl creams provide deep hydration and nourishment, defining curls while reducing frizz. They are ideal for individuals with dry, coarse, or thick curls.
  • Gels: Curl gels offer strong hold and definition, preventing curls from becoming frizzy or undefined. They are suitable for individuals with fine, wavy, or curly hair.
  • Leave-in Conditioners: Leave-in conditioners provide continuous hydration and detangling benefits, promoting healthy hair growth. They are beneficial for all curl types, especially those prone to dryness or breakage.
  • Styling Aids: Styling aids such as mousses and hairsprays provide additional hold and control, shaping and enhancing curls. They are ideal for special occasions or when a more polished look is desired.

Ingredients

Pattern hair products are designed specifically to meet the unique needs of curly, coily, and textured hair. A critical component of these products is the inclusion of natural ingredients that hydrate, strengthen, and protect the hair. These ingredients work synergistically to improve the overall health and appearance of curls.

Natural oils, such as coconut oil, argan oil, and shea butter, provide deep conditioning and nourishment to the hair shaft. They penetrate the hair cuticle, replenishing lost moisture and restoring elasticity. Butters, like mango butter and cocoa butter, further enhance hydration and create a protective barrier around the hair, shielding it from environmental damage.

Humectants, such as glycerin and honey, draw moisture from the air into the hair, helping to keep it hydrated and prevent dryness. Proteins, like keratin and collagen, strengthen the hair shaft, reducing breakage and promoting healthy hair growth. By combining these natural ingredients, pattern hair products provide comprehensive care for textured hair, addressing its specific needs and promoting overall hair health.
